This research and reference text provides a comprehensive and authoritative survey of the state-of-the-art in terahertz electronics research. Covering the fundamentals, operational principles, and theoretical aspects of the field, the book equips the reader to take the practical steps involved in the fabrication of devices that work in the terahertz frequency range. Volume one focuses on solid-state devices and vacuum tubes, discussing Schottky, MIM, self-switching, geometric, resonant tunneling, IMPATT and Gunn diodes, HBTs, MOSFETs, and HEMTs, as well as traveling wave tubes, backward wave oscillators, gyrotrons and free electron lasers.
